Lubricating oil compositions providing superior soot dispersing characteristics, which contain a combination of a high molecular weight dispersant and a soot dispersant comprising a linked aromatic oligomer of the formula (I) wherein each Ar independently represents an aromatic moeity selected from polynuclear carbocyclic coieties, mononuclear heterocyclic moieties and polynuclera heterocyclic moieties, said aromatic moiety being optionally substituted by 1 to 6 substituents selected from H, -OR1, -N(R1)2, F, Cl, Br, I, -(L-(Ar)-T), -S(O)wR1, -(CZ)x-(Z)y-R1 and (Z)y-(CZ)x-R1, wherein w is 0 to 3, each Z is independently O, -N(R1)2 or S, x and y are independently 0 or 1 and each R1 is independently H or a linear of branched, saturated or unsaturated hydrocarbyl group having from 1 to about 200 carbon atoms, optionally mono- or poly-substituted with one or more group selected from -OR2, -N(R2)2, F, Cl, Br, I, -S(O)wR2, -(CZ)x-(Z)y-R2 and -(Z)y-(CZ)x-R2, wherein w, x, y and Z are as defined above and R2 is a hydrocarbyl group having 1 to about 200 cargon atoms; each L is independently a linking moiety comprising a carbon-carbon single bond or a linking group; each T is independently H, -OR¿1?, -N(R1)2, F, Cl, Br, I, -S(O)wR1, -(CZ)x-(Z)y-R1 or (Z)y-(CZ)x-R1 wherein R1, w, x, y and Z are as defined above, and n is 2 to about 1000; wherein at least 25 % or aromatic moieties (Ar) are connected to at least 2 linking moieties (L) and a ratio of the total number of aliphatic carbon atoms in the oligomer to the total number of aromatic ring atoms in aromatic moieties (Ar) is from about 0.10:1 to about 40:1. |
